🥣 Step-by-Step Instructions
1. Make the Pretzel Crust
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C).
Crush pretzels in a food processor or place in a zip-top bag and crush with a rolling pin.
In a mixing bowl, combine crushed pretzels, melted butter, and sugar until evenly coated.
Press the mixture firmly into the bottom of a 9×13-inch baking dish, making sure it’s tightly packed.
Bake for 8–10 minutes, then let cool completely.
2. Prepare the Cream Cheese Layer
In a large bowl, beat softened cream cheese and sugar together until smooth and creamy.
Gently fold in the whipped topping until well combined.
Spread evenly over the cooled pretzel crust, making sure to seal all the edges (this prevents the Jell-O from seeping into the crust).
Place in the refrigerator to chill while preparing the Jell-O layer.
3. Make the Strawberry Topping
In a medium bowl, dissolve the strawberry gelatin in 2 cups of boiling water, stirring until fully dissolved.
Stir in 2 cups of cold water (or a mix of ice + cold water to speed up cooling).
Allow the mixture to sit at room temperature until it thickens slightly—about 10–15 minutes.
Stir in the sliced strawberries.
4. Assemble the Dessert
Carefully pour the strawberry mixture over the cream cheese layer.
Refrigerate until the Jell-O is fully set, at least 4–6 hours (overnight is best).
🍴 Serving Tips
Cut into squares and serve chilled.
For a pretty presentation, garnish with extra whipped topping, fresh strawberries, or even a drizzle of chocolate.
🌟 Pro Tips for the Best Strawberry Pretzel Salad
Seal the cream cheese layer well: This is the key to keeping the pretzel crust crunchy.
Don’t skip cooling: Let each layer chill before adding the next for perfect, clean layers.
Variations: Try raspberry Jell-O with raspberries, or even a peach version with peach gelatin and slices.
Make ahead: Best made the night before so the Jell-O has plenty of time to set.
